Gondola

Definition: The definition of a gondola is an enclosed car suspended from an overhead cable that is used to transport passengers up and down a mountain. Gondola cars come in many different sizes, seating anywhere between four and twelve passengers each. They may be heated, and some even feature speakers to play piped-in music.
Pronunciation: [gon-dl-uh]
Also Known As: Gondi, gondola car, cable car, ganja-la.
Examples:
It was so cold today that we mostly rode the gondola to keep warm on the way up the hill.
